Clif Basnight joins Ultra I&C as strategic technologies VP

Clif Basnight has been named Ultra Intelligence & Communications’ new vice president of strategic technologies, the Austin, TX-based company announced July 18.  In this role, Basnight will be responsible for analyzing current and emerging markets to identify opportunities for growth through the development and/or acquisition of cutting-edge technologies. He will lead strategic growth initiatives across Ultra I&C on behalf of the organization’s chief growth officer.

“I joined the Ultra I&C team for the opportunity to work with the world’s finest collection of tactical communications engineers, mission-focused software designers and multi-national cybersecurity experts,” said Basnight. “This team is on the cusp of forging new and innovative ways of reducing the cognitive workload of operators on the battlefield and increasing the speed of relevant information to the tactical edge so that warfighters can focus on mission execution and not fighting the network.”

Basnight’s career spans over 20 years with various leadership roles in all-source intelligence analysis, network engineering, information architecture, product development, business development, capture, and sales. During his 17 years of service in the U.S. Army, Basnight held positions as both a soldier and civil servant. His culminating role as a soldier was as an All-Source Intelligence Master Analyst (1F) in the 4th Infantry Division, where he was responsible for the integration of emerging SIGINT, ELINT, and HUMINT applications in support of targeting.

As an Army civil servant, his final role was as chief engineer for Product Manager Network Systems under the Program Executive Office for Command, Control, and Communications-Tactical (PEO C3T). In this position, he orchestrated the network modernization strategy for the PdM’s portfolio of tactical network solutions deployed across the Army. He also led the network operations activities for the Army’s premier experimentation and integration event.

“We are excited to have Clif join the Ultra I&C team,” said Chris Bishop, chief growth officer. “His expertise and passion align perfectly with our mission and vision, and we are confident that his unique perspective will drive our growth and success.”

Basnight holds a bachelor’s degree from Excelsior College and a master’s degree in information technology from Virginia Polytechnic Institute and State University. He received a Bronze Star during Operation Iraqi Freedom and is a recipient of the Signal Corps Regimental Association Bronze Order of Mercury.
